





















































Transform Your GRC Program. No More Chasing Evidence.
If you’re responsible for the GRC program in your organization, don't chase stakeholders for evidence.
Use Anecdotes to continuously and indepandantly monitor your tech stack with credible GRC data.
Whether you’re complying with SOX, NIST, PCI, or a custom framework, stop managing them in isolation. With Anecdotes’ advanced cross-mapping solution, you can reuse shared evidence across different scopes. Focus on strategy and strengthen your GRC program with Anecdotes.
Sponsored
🦋 Welcome to BIPro #78 – Your Weekly Business Intelligence Boost! 🚀
Dive into this week’s freshest trends, strategies, and insights designed to elevate your data-driven success!
📊 Future-Ready Data Visualization Trends
✦ Low-Code AI Revolution: Harness Kumologica and Anthropic AI for effortless integration!
✦ Search Engine Mastery: Craft powerful algorithms with ClickHouse.
✦ LLM Apps Supercharged: Unlock potential using DSPy and Langfuse.
✦ Voice Flow Simplified: Discover the ease of the new OpenAI Realtime API.
✦ Data Tables Made Easy: Kickstart your Python web apps with robust data solutions.
✦ Power BI Highlights: Your guide to the September 2024 features.
🔄 Transformative Success Stories in BI
✦ Data Management Made Simple: Efficiently delete large data sets in SQL Server.
✦ Natural Language Queries: Unlock SQL with user-friendly applications.
✦ SQL Server Insights: Navigate stored procedures, functions, and views seamlessly.
✦ AI Alignment Unpacked: Explore the Gridworlds problem for innovative solutions.
✦ AI Success Formula: Combining Kafka with AI guardrails for optimal performance.
✦ Monthly BI Update: Fabric’s latest enhancements for September 2024.
⚡ Instant Impact: Quick BI Hacks
✦ LLM Integration Simplified: Leverage Scikit-Learn with Scikit-LLM effortlessly.
✦ Command-Line Mastery: Build sleek Python apps using Click.
✦ AI Chatbot Evolution: Maintain message history with LangChain and SQL.
✦ Text Data Transformation: Get AI-ready with no-code solutions.
✦ Seamless Integration: Google Cloud Cortex Framework meets Oracle EBS.
🎤 BI Voices: Wisdom from Industry Leaders
✦ Keynotes to Remember: Highlights from Microsoft and Redgate, plus insights from PASS Data Community Summit.
✦ SQL Search Optimization: Master SQL LIKE wildcard searches for better performance.
✦ Vector Search Simplified: Zero ETL solutions for Amazon DynamoDB with OpenSearch Service.
✦ Alteryx Applications Unveiled: Discover 6 common use cases for impactful data meaning.
✦ Streamlined Migration: Transitioning from Alteryx to Microsoft Fabric made easy.
Get ready to boost your business intelligence game! Happy reading!
Calling All Data & BI Enthusiasts!
Do you dream of sharing your insights and building your reputation in the Data & BI community? Contribute to our new column in the Packt BIPro newsletter! Share your experiences, discuss new BI tools, or ask questions. Gain recognition among 37,000 BI professionals. Reply with your Google Docs article or use our weekly feedback form. Enjoy a free PDF of "Interactive Data Visualization with Python - Second Edition" for participating. Click reply or share your content today!
Share your thoughts and opinions here!
Cheers,
Merlyn Shelley
Editor-in-Chief, Packt
➽ AI-Assisted Programming for Web and Machine Learning: Unlock the power of AI-assisted programming to streamline web development and machine learning. Learn to enhance frontend and backend coding, optimize ML models, and automate tasks using GitHub Copilot and ChatGPT. Perfect for boosting productivity and refining workflows. Start your free trial for access, renewing at $19.99/month.
➽ Machine Learning and Generative AI for Marketing: Leverage AI and Python to revolutionize your marketing strategies with predictive analytics and personalized content creation. Learn to combine advanced segmentation techniques and generative AI to boost customer engagement while ensuring ethical AI practices. Perfect for driving real business growth. Start your free trial for access, renewing at $19.99/month.
➽ Amazon DynamoDB - The Definitive Guide: Master Amazon DynamoDB with this comprehensive guide, learning key-value data modeling, optimized strategies for transitioning from RDBMS, and efficient read consistency. Discover advanced techniques like caching and analytics integration with AWS services to boost performance, while minimizing latency and costs. Start your free trial for access, renewing at $19.99/month.
➽ Microsoft Power BI Performance Best Practices - Second Edition: Master Power BI performance optimization with this guide, learning to build efficient data models, apply row-level security, and troubleshoot issues using DAX Studio and VertiPaq Analyzer. Implement formal performance management strategies to ensure scalable, high-performing solutions. Start your free trial for access, renewing at $19.99/month.
➽ Polars Cookbook: Unlock faster, more efficient data analysis with Python Polars through step-by-step recipes. Master data manipulation, advanced querying, and performance optimization. Learn to handle large datasets, perform complex transformations, and integrate Polars with other tools. Start your free trial for access, renewing at $19.99/month.
➽ Low Code AI Agent Using Kumologica, Anthropic AI: This blog discusses how to use Kumologica and Anthropic AI to create an AI agent for customer feedback analysis in a mobile app. It walks through building an API, analyzing sentiment, and storing results in AWS DynamoDB.
➽ Create a Search Engine, Algorithm With ClickHouse: This blog explains how to build a cost-effective, alternative search engine using ClickHouse instead of Elasticsearch. It covers indexing, scoring, and matching search queries with a unified dataset, improving search performance and efficiency.
➽ Supercharge Your LLM Apps Using DSPy and Langfuse: This blog explores the rise of large language models (LLMs) and highlights challenges like prompt engineering. It introduces DSPy and Langfuse, frameworks to simplify LLM app development, optimize performance, and enhance debugging through observability and modular design.
➽ Exploring How the New OpenAI Realtime API Simplifies Voice Agent Flows: This article reviews OpenAI's new Realtime API, which simplifies building low-latency, speech-to-speech AI applications. It compares previous multi-service voice agent workflows with the streamlined Realtime API setup, showcasing implementation, cost analysis, and potential benefits.
➽ Getting Started with Powerful Data Tables in Your Python Web Apps: This blog details how a Python developer can create an interactive, feature-rich data grid using the Reflex framework and AG Grid without needing JavaScript. It explains building a finance app to display and manipulate stock data, with features like sorting, filtering, and graphing.
➽ Power BI September 2024 Feature Summary: This post highlights Power BI's new features, including the much-anticipated Dark Mode, default cross-page summaries in Copilot, a streamlined menu bar, and Metrics Hub for consistent data management. It also introduces updates for visual calculations and formatting options.
➽ How to Delete Large Amounts of Data in Microsoft SQL Server? This blog discusses efficient techniques for large-scale data deletion in Microsoft SQL Server, including batching with the DELETE command, using TRUNCATE, partition switching, SELECT INTO, disabling indexes, and applying table locks. It emphasizes best practices like monitoring log growth and testing in non-production environments.
➽ Natural Language SQL Query Application: This blog details building a web app that converts natural language into SQL queries using React, Node.js, PostgreSQL, and OpenAI. It simplifies querying for non-technical users, enabling seamless database interactions with natural language inputs, improving data accessibility.
➽ SQL Server Metadata for Stored Procedures, Functions and Views: This blog demonstrates how to create, use, and track SQL modules like user-defined functions, stored procedures, and views in SQL Server. It also covers best practices for managing these modules using T-SQL scripts and metadata queries for efficient database management.
➽ Exploring the AI Alignment Problem with Gridworlds: The blog discusses the AI alignment problem, highlighting risks of advanced AI misaligning with human interests. It critiques common objections, explores hidden objectives in AI learning, and introduces "AI Safety Gridworlds" for testing AI behavior without explicit instructions.
➽ How to succeed with AI: Combining Kafka and AI Guardrails? This article explores the intersection of AI and Kafka, emphasizing the necessity of AI guardrails to mitigate risks like data leaks and bias. It argues that effective AI relies on real-time data streaming and robust governance for optimal performance.
➽ Fabric September 2024 Monthly Update: This post highlights exciting updates for FabCon Europe, including Copilot integration in Dataflows Gen2 and Power BI, enhanced Git functionality, a redesigned Real-Time hub, and new features in Data Engineering and Data Science for improved AI data management and collaboration.
➽ Integrating LLMs with Scikit-Learn Using Scikit-LLM: This post introduces the Scikit-LLM library, bridging Scikit-Learn and large language models for enhanced text classification. It details installation, backend support, and implementation of a zero-shot text classifier on a sentiment analysis dataset, showcasing improved performance.
➽ Building Command Line Apps in Python with Click: This blog discusses the Click library for Python, which simplifies the creation of command-line applications. It covers features like easy command composition, integration with other libraries, and provides examples for building a file organizer and calculating rectangle areas.
➽ AI Chatbot with Message History using LangChain and SQL: This blog provides a tutorial on enhancing LLM applications by adding message history and a user interface using LangChain. It guides readers through building a Flask chatbot, integrating local memory, and using prompt templates for better interactions.
➽ Making Text Data AI-Ready. An introduction using no-code solutions: This blog explains how to make unstructured text data AI-ready for large language models (LLMs), outlining the importance of formatting, specifically using Markdown, and providing no-code tools like Jina AI and LlamaParse for efficient text processing.
➽ Google Cloud Cortex Framework integrated with Oracle EBS: This blog discusses the importance of rapid data access for businesses, highlighting the integration of Oracle E-Business Suite with Google Cloud’s Cortex Framework to enhance data visibility, improve order-to-cash processes, and facilitate actionable insights.
➽ Presenting the Microsoft Keynote, Redgate Keynote, and a community star - PASS Data Community Summit: The PASS Summit 2024 is a premier event for data professionals, featuring three keynotes from industry leaders on AI innovation with Azure Databases, practical Database DevOps solutions, and leveraging AI to enhance productivity. Attendees can explore various learning pathways and engage in valuable networking opportunities.
➽ Optimize SQL LIKE Wildcard Searches: This blog addresses the inefficiencies of full wildcard searches using SQL's LIKE operator in Microsoft SQL Server. It explores optimization techniques, including binary collation and Full-Text Search, to enhance query performance and minimize execution time significantly.
➽ Vector search for Amazon DynamoDB with zero ETL for Amazon OpenSearch Service: This blog explains how to integrate Amazon DynamoDB with Amazon OpenSearch Service and Amazon Bedrock for advanced data insights and generative AI capabilities. It covers setting up zero-ETL integration, generating embeddings, and enhancing search functionalities through practical examples.
➽ What is Alteryx Used For: 6 Common Use Cases. This blog introduces Alteryx, an analytics automation platform that streamlines data collection, preparation, and blending to provide actionable insights. It highlights its applications in data analytics, predictive modeling, and geospatial analysis, offering consultation services for businesses to optimize their data processes.
➽ Automated Migration - Alteryx To Microsoft Fabric Conversion: This blog discusses the challenges and considerations involved in migrating workflows from Alteryx to Microsoft Fabric. It highlights differences in functionality, data integration, workflow complexity, and advanced analytics, providing insights to facilitate a successful migration process.